One of the most important developments in building construction has been the evolution of admixtures. These are special materials added to fresh mixes to improve their workability, durability, and strength. They allow us to deliver customised solutions that meet the exact requirements of each project, from residential driveways to complex industrial works. Without them, achieving modern standards of performance would be far more difficult and less efficient. Admixtures work at the microscopic level, changing the way particles and water interact inside a fresh mix. By adjusting hydration and bonding, these additives fine-tune how a structure will perform once cured. Scientists and engineers continue to develop more advanced versions, making it easier to adapt to different climates, conditions, and project demands. The underlying science makes admixtures not only practical but also crucial for the future of construction.
Admixtures aren’t simply chemical additions; they actively control how a mixture reacts over time. They can alter the speed of setting, improve density, and enhance the final finish in remarkable ways. Using admixtures correctly is about matching the right product to the project’s needs. Proper planning, accurate measurement, and careful mixing are essential for success. Without these steps, the advantages of admixtures may not fully come through.
While admixtures provide powerful benefits, misuse can lead to serious issues. Adding too much, mixing the wrong types, or ignoring guidelines can compromise strength and durability. Many common mistakes happen when people underestimate how precise these additives need to be. Avoiding these pitfalls ensures that the benefits of admixtures are fully realised.
